>웹 프론트엔드 >JS 튜토리얼 >JavaScript에서 전체 문서 HTML을 문자열로 얻는 방법은 무엇입니까?

JavaScript에서 전체 문서 HTML을 문자열로 얻는 방법은 무엇입니까?

DDD
DDD원래의
2024-10-29 09:17:02532검색

How to Get the Full Document HTML as a String in JavaScript?

문자열로 전체 문서 HTML에 액세스

JavaScript에서는 문자열로 태그를 지정합니다. 일반적으로 이 방법은 로깅이나 디버깅 목적으로 웹 페이지 스크랩, 문서의 현재 상태 캡처 등의 작업을 용이하게 하는 데 사용됩니다.

해결책:

어떤 접근 방식에 관계없이 선택하면 프로세스에는 루트 document.documentElement로 참조되는 요소.

innerHTML 사용:
태그 자체를 제외한 태그에서는 .innerHTML 속성을 활용합니다.

const html = document.documentElement.innerHTML;

이 메소드는 및 태그.

outerHTML 사용:
반대로, 콘텐츠와 함께 태그를 지정하려면 .outerHTML 속성을 활용하세요.

const html = document.documentElement.outerHTML;

이 방법은 태그와 태그가 캡슐화하는 HTML 콘텐츠.

문서 HTML의 이러한 문자열 표현은 추가 처리, 조작 또는 표시를 위해 변수에 할당될 수 있습니다.

위 내용은 JavaScript에서 전체 문서 HTML을 문자열로 얻는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.